StreetWise is not just an Attitude....It's an Exhibition

37 amazing artists in this international Juried show 
now showing at the new
Verum Ultimum Art Gallery in Portland, Oregon.  
This small gallery nestled in a mostly residential neighborhood
 ( near Mcmenamins Kennedy School Restaurant) packs a punch
 displaying over45 works by artists from Oregon, Washington, and throughout the world.  
The works were juried in in a highly selective process
 (the jurors reviewed over 250 works).  

Unusual  mediums and striking images define this show, they include:
 Constance Brinkley's apropos Metal Print  Rainy Day in Seattle  (Photography), 
Feature Artist, Beth Kerschen's work (and her original spin on the printmaking technique of Polymer Photogravure)
Rachel Rose's Rapture (embroidrey on a record sleeve)
Deborah Paul's Cityscape (reycled post consumer tins, bike inner tubes, and board)
Paul Griffitt's Eschervile (3d fractal print)
